    The ServiceNow®Smart Assessment Engine (SAE) helps you reduce the manual burden and costs of your assessment processes through automation.

    Smart Assessment Engine

    In Governance, Risk, and Compliance (GRC) workflows such as compliance management, vendor risk management, privacy management, audit management, business continuity, and operational risk management, organizations face challenges in gathering input from employees and making informed decisions. Manual processes can be inefficient, time-consuming, and prone to errors, leading to increased operational costs and compliance risks.

    SAE is designed to automate and optimize assessment processes, reducing manual efforts and costs. It provides an intuitive, configurable, and access-controlled assessment experience, enabling organizations to design and execute assessments seamlessly while ensuring compliance and efficiency. SAE is a versatile and business-friendly assessment engine that simplifies data collection, risk analysis, and compliance management. It supports a drag-and-drop template designer for effortless assessment creation and includes predefined roles to align with standard user personas. SAE ensures end-to-end workflow automation, post-assessment actions, and seamless collaboration.

    By implementing SAE, organizations can streamline assessments, enhance accountability, and ensure regulatory compliance while optimizing overall efficiency. It enables organizations to track risks, maintain compliance, and improve decision-making through standardized evaluation processes.

    Roles of SAE users

    Assessment actor
    A user with the assessment actor [sn_smart_asmt.actor] role can respond to the assessments that are assigned to them. They can also reassign these assessments.
    Assessment reader
    A user with the assessment reader [sn_smart_asmt.assessment_reader] role can read the assessments within the categories that they’re assigned to. Additionally, they can read and comment on the assessments they created, and view and comment on the assessments that are generated from those templates.
    Note:
    The Assessment reader role field in the template determines the minimum user role that is required to view and comment on assessments. Only users with the specified role and the Assessment reader [sn_smart_asmt.assessment_reader] role can access the assessments that are generated from this template.
    Assessment Admin
    A user with the assessment admin [sn_smart_asmt.assessment_admin] role can create, view, update, and delete both template categories and assessment templates. Additionally, the user with this role can view all the assessments, modify their states, reassign the assessments, and migrate the existing metric types to new assessment templates.
    Template reader
    A user with the template reader [sn_smart_asmt.template_reader] role can read specific assessment templates that are based on the categories mapped to the templates.
    Note:
    Each template must be mapped to one or more template category. A template reader must have this role to view the templates that are mapped with that category. A template reader must be able to access a template category to view the template.
    Template Manager
    A user with the template manager [sn_smart_asmt.template_manager] role can read, write, or create specific assessment templates that are based on the categories that are mapped to these templates. Their access to the template categories during the creation process is governed by the same rules that apply to the template readers.
    Template Developer
    A user with the template admin or template manager role and template [sn_smart_asmt.developer] role can read, write, and create the script for response automation in assessment questions.
